Nothing like stumbling across a recent gem in the underground. Molde Volhal are yet another one-man Black Metal act with a recently released debut, and they aren't here to do anything groundbreaking or novel. No, what they're here to do is play Epic Black Metal with blistering tremolo riffs, croaks low enough in the mix to sound like they're coming from some far-off blizzard, slower melodic sections led by synth work reminiscent of old Summoning, and a raw production that still allows enough room to make the music sound massive. Sure, you could say it's a bit cheesy and unoriginal, but then I'd call you a fucking nerd for acting like that's a bad thing to be. If you got big, freezing riffs and bitcrushed horns that sound like a pumped-up soundtrack to Baldur's Gate or something and you do it with conviction, odds are I'll be ripping off my shirt and pounding my chest while I hoot like a howler monkey, and Into the Cave of Ordeals... is good enough to get me to do just that. A band to watch.
